
Competitive gaming is a thrilling and dynamic world, where players are constantly seeking the perfect balance between skill and luck. In any competitive game, there are two main elements at play: the player’s skills and abilities, and the unpredictable nature of random number generation (RNG). Balancing these two factors is crucial in the design of a successful competitive game.
Skill-based gameplay is the foundation of competitive gaming. It rewards players for their dedication, practice, and strategic thinking. A game that is purely skill-based relies solely on the player’s abilities to outmaneuver, outwit, and outperform their opponents. Games like chess, fighting games, and MOBAs (Multiplayer Online Battle Arena) are great examples of skill-based competitive games.
On the other hand, RNG introduces an element of unpredictability into the gameplay. Random events, such as critical hits, item drops, or card draws, can affect the outcome of a match. While RNG can add excitement and variety to a game, it can also be frustrating for players who feel that their skill is being overshadowed by luck.
Balancing skill and RNG in competitive game design is a delicate art. A game that is too heavily reliant on skill may alienate casual players or become stale over time, as the strategies become predictable. On the other hand, a game that is too RNG-dependent may feel unfair or lacking in depth, as players are unable to fully control their fate.
One approach to balancing skill and RNG is to provide players with opportunities to mitigate the effects of luck. Another strategy is to design game mechanics that reward both skill and RNG in different ways. For example, in a game like Rocket League, players must rely on their skill to control their cars and score goals, but they also need to adapt to the unpredictable physics of the ball and the arena.
Ultimately, the key to a successful competitive game is to strike a balance between skill and RNG that keeps players engaged and challenged. By designing gameplay mechanics that reward both skillful play and adaptability to RNG, developers can create a dynamic and exciting competitive experience that appeals to a wide range of players.
